SeaLead Shipping, Headquarters's Singaporean-based shipping company, has suspended services on its Far East-US-West route.Previously, due to the sharp drop in freight demand, some new liner companies also withdrew from the route.

SeaLead, which initially focused on the Asia-Persian Gulf route, joined several other regional airlines on the trans-Pacific route in August 2021, when supply chain bottlenecks pushed long-haul rates to record highs.

A SeaLead spokesperson said, "Like other shipping companies, SeaLead pays close attention to market changes and their impact on business and customers. In view of this, we have recently adjusted our route network, which we believe will provide more choices and pay close attention to market changes." Monitor market changes. Reflect changing customer needs. "The company's western U.S. service has been suspended but will continue to monitor trade routes, according to the spokesman.

At the same time, TS Lines terminated its joint foreign trade route cooperation agreement with Antang Holdings in December last year and withdrew from the Asia-Europe route.A TS Lines source said: "We are completing the last wholesale shipment to Europe andOf the eastern United StatesGoods, is expected to withdraw from these routes in March.Freight volumes and freight rates have dropped dramatically and it makes no sense to continue. Therefore, carriers will seek to optimize their fleets, deploy ships on more profitable routes and fulfill contractual commitments more widely on Asia-Europe and trans-Pacific routes through space sharing, which may become less common among alliances.It is becoming more and more common.

On January 15th this year, Hapag-Lloyd, a member of THE Alliance, announced that he had signed a new cabin lease agreement with CMA CGM, a member of Ocean Alliance, adding FE9 to European route service and sharing FAL3 service of CMA CGM Asia-North route.

Hapag-Lloyd representationThis will enhance its network coverage and provide forNorthern EuropeTourismProvide dedicated connection.The agreement will come into effect in February 2023, and the maiden voyage is scheduled to sail from Qingdao Port on February 14.

At the same time, Beurotte also announced that CGX, an independent Sino-German express service launched during the peak demand period, will be suspended from February.

According to Alphaliner, CMA CGM and ONE, a member of the alliance, also submitted amendments to the Trans-Pacific Route Space Exchange Agreement, which will exchange space with the Pearl River Express service operated by CMA. FP1 Loop operated by CGM and ONE.
